Quick Answer
Using game bags when packing meat ensures that it stays clean, dry, and protected from the elements, reducing the risk of contamination and spoilage. This is especially important when quartering large game like mule deer, where the meat needs to be handled and hauled with care. Proper packaging helps maintain the quality of the meat for consumption.
Importance of Cleanliness
When handling and packing game, cleanliness is crucial to prevent cross-contamination and spoilage. Game bags provide a contained environment that shields the meat from dirt, debris, and other external factors. This is particularly important when quartering a large game like mule deer, where the meat is exposed and vulnerable to contamination. By using game bags, you can ensure that the meat remains clean and free from external contaminants.
Quartering and Packing Techniques
When quartering a mule deer, it’s essential to remove the meat from the bones and pack it efficiently into the game bags. A rule of thumb is to pack the meat in a way that allows for even distribution of weight and prevents damage to the meat or the bags. For a mule deer, you can aim to pack 10-15 pounds of meat per bag, depending on the size of the animal and the type of game bags being used. This will help distribute the weight evenly and prevent the bags from becoming too heavy or unwieldy.
Game Bag Selection and Considerations
When selecting game bags, consider the size, material, and durability of the bags. For quartering a mule deer, you’ll want bags that can hold 10-15 pounds of meat each, with a durable material that can withstand the weight and potential rough handling. Look for bags made from water-resistant materials like nylon or polyester, and consider the size and shape of the bags to ensure they fit comfortably into your backpack or pack. Additionally, consider the type of closure system used on the bags, as you’ll want something that’s easy to seal and secure.
